Novavax $NVAX Deep Dive

Executive Summary: Novavax is a biotechnology company committed to addressing serious infectious diseases globally through the discovery, development, and delivery of innovative vaccines. The company was founded in 1987 and is headquartered in Gaithersburg, Maryland. Novavax focuses on developing life-saving vaccines to fight infectious diseases, using a combination of recombinant protein approach, nanoparticle technology, and its patented…

Read More